Ticket: DEDUP-412 — Connection failures during customer record dedup

The Larkspur dedup job started failing overnight with pool exhaustion errors. It merges duplicate customer records in batches of 500, but the batch worker isn't releasing connections after a merge conflict, so the pool drains within twenty minutes. Proposed fix: wrap merges in a try/finally release and cap retries at three. For the sync, reproduce against staging using the connection string below.

primary connection of bagep-kaweg = clickhouse://rusdor_svc:3TXlgH7O8DuUYI@db-ae3f.zarqelgrid.internal:5432/zordor

## Formula sandbox tuning

User-supplied formulas in Gridmoor execute inside a restricted interpreter with hard ceilings on time, memory, and call depth. Reviewers should confirm any change to these ceilings is justified in the PR description, since raising them widens the abuse surface. Defaults were chosen from production traces. The current limits are as follows.

limits module of tafog-fawip:
WEIGHTS = {
    "julix": 57,
    "lamys": 992,
    "kasvan": 209,
    "quenok": 750,
    "alddor": 259,
    "oliath": 1009,
    "wenix": 815,
}

**Runbook — Digest scheduling (Pennow Mail).** Batch email digests for Pennow are assembled nightly by the Lanternfold scheduler. If a customer reports a missing digest, first confirm their timezone bucket ran: check the scheduler dashboard for their region and verify the assembly job finished before the send window opened. Do not manually re-trigger a send without confirming deduplication is enabled, or subscribers may receive duplicates. Quote the run's trace token, shown below, in any escalation.

pipeline stamp: htk21_86b657ac0aa916a9af17f

Quick heads-up for the GreenLoop release: the /calibrate endpoint now auto-corrects sensor drift on humidity probes every six hours, so you no longer need the nightly cron hack. Drift thresholds are configurable per zone via the controller config. To smoke-test against the staging VerdantCore service, authenticate using the internal key below.

gateway credential: qvz3-qsf